MP questions NFC beef safety following poisoning case


An opposition MP has questioned the safety of National Feedlot Corporation’s (NFC) beef supply following tests last year that reported six of its cattle had died of copper poisoning.

"The minister must confirm if all meat produced by NFC is free from copper toxicity and if the ministry has stringent inspections following the discovery of copper poisoning (in NFC beef) last year," said PJ Utara MP Tony Pua.

At a press conference at Parliament House today, Pua cited Veterinary Services tests on carcasses of six NGC cattle found dead last year from copper poisoning.

The matter, he said, must be explained as "not only are taxpayers' monies are involved, but the health of Malaysians is also at stake".
